单片机课程设计-----基于DS1302的电子钟设计 第 2 页 共 23 页 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第1页。单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第1页。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第1页。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第1页。 单片机课程设计 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第2页。单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第2页。设计题目:基于DS1302的电子钟设计 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第2页。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第2页。 系统设计思路 要求能利用试验箱上的DS1302来显示当前时间,日期,并将其显示在数码管和液晶屏上。此设计即液晶上显示年、月、日、时、分、秒、星期,电路包括以下几个部分:单片机、时钟电路、显示电路 各部分说明: 单片机通过输出各种电脉冲信号来驱动控制各部分正常工作。 单片机发送的信号经过显示电路通过译码最终在液晶上显示出来。 系统的主要元件:主芯片:MCS—51单片机 时钟芯片:DS1302 显示器件:LED和LCD(T6963C) 系统工作过程:时间的主要处理过程是在DS1302中完成的。首先对此芯片进行初始化,对其初值进行设置,然后启动芯片工作。芯片会在内部晶振提供的频率下对秒进行加计数并在必要时进位。 CPU会随时对DS1302进行读取数据的操作。在读取了相应的寄存器的值后,CPU将读取的值进行处理,再通过I\O口把数据传入LED和LCD。显示器件在接受到数据后在相应的位置上进行显示。 系统的设计按照系统的工作过程,将CPU相应的I\O口分配给对应的芯片完成相应的控制和数据的传递。简单地可概括为以CPU为中心,将DS1302的时间数据,通过CPU处理后输入到T6963C和LED进行输出显示 单元电路设计 MCS-51单片机系统设计 MCS51核心实验板上的外设电路,使用了单片机的P1口和P3口。P1口和P3口的各个引脚,可以根据需要,用于控制核心板本身的外设器件,也可以通过核心板上面的插针,用于其它的外部控制功能,或者通过通用实验板连接插口,用于通用板的控制。通过改变拨码开关的位置,可以设定P1口和P3口各引脚用于核心板内部或外部。 CPU相应电路原理如图1.2.3所示。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第3页。单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第3页。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第3页。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第3页。 图1.2.3 MCS51核心实验板CPU电路原理图 CPU的P1口和P3口分别用拨码开关SW1和SW2来选择它们是用于控制核心板还是外接到连接插口上供通用板使用。当拨码开关某一位处于"ON"的位置时,P1口和P3口对应引脚连接到核心板,否则连接到通用板。全部P0、P1、P2、P3口引脚分别接到一排插针上,可通过排线连接到其它应用电路。 DS1302时钟芯片电路设计 数字时钟电路DS1302位于通用板的 区,电路连接如图1.3.15所示。由于不用备份电源,所以将VCC1和VCC2引脚都连接到数字电源上。 图1.3.15 DS1302数字时钟电路 DS1320的SCLK、IO、/RST引脚分别经一个10KΩ上拉电阻连接到数字电源,同时连接到端子"TSCK"、"TIO"和"TRST"上。用户只要根据自己的设计,将这三个端子连接到单片机对应的引脚,就可以使用DS1302时钟功能。 点阵液晶显示器 选用香港精电公司的QH12864T液晶显示模块,其背面带有控制电路,内置有LCD控制器T6963C。点阵LCD的数据线、地址线、控制线等,在内部已经与单片机扩展总线连接好,如图1.3.7所示。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第4页。单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第4页。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第4页。 单片机课程设计-----基于DS1302的电子钟设计全文共23页,当前为第4页。 图1.3.7 点阵LCD电路原理 只须根据需要,将单片机的高位地址译码输出,连接到片选信号"LCDCS"端子,就可以得到需要的地址。例如,假定片选信号"LCDCS"连
, 相关下载链接:
https://download.csdn.net/download/qq_43934844/87506242?utm_source=bbsseo